Make Your Own Scented Turmeric Soap Bridal Shower Gifts

If you want to give out a wonderful gift for your bridal shower, why not make your own turmeric soaps? Place these in beautiful favor bags or boxes, and you’ll have a gift your friends will adore. Plus, turmeric soap is very simple to make. Here’s what you’ll need:

Ingredients

  • Glycerin Blocks – 1 Pound per 3-5 Guests
  • Turmeric Powder – 1-2 tablespoons (adjust to preference)
  • Essential Oil in Your Favorite Scent (like lavender or tea tree)
  • Soap Molds of Your Choice
  • Plastic Cellophane Wrap

Instructions

You’ll need a double boiler for this, but if you don’t have one, you can create an improvised version. Simply place a glass or metal bowl in a pot of boiling water (it’s best if the bowl fits just inside the pot). Your glycerin blocks will go inside the bowl.

  1. Chop the glycerin blocks and place them in the bowl, stirring occasionally as they melt. Eventually, they will become all liquid.
  2. Once melted, carefully (use pot holders) pour the glycerin into the soap molds.
  3. Allow the glycerin to cool for a few minutes before adding your turmeric powder, as adding it when too hot may alter its properties. Stir well to combine.
  4. Wait until the mixture has cooled but isn’t yet firm, then add 5-10 drops of your chosen essential oil to each mold.
  5. Allow the soap to cool completely before popping it out and wrapping it in cellophane.

Customization

You can make your soap more fun by adding other ingredients to the glycerin mixture. Consider adding oatmeal for exfoliation, or mix in dried flowers for added texture and beauty. It’s a lot of fun, and your friends are sure to love these unique and aromatic gifts!
